  • Abstract
    Sometimes scientists would like to put their heads into interesting parts of their data sets and look around, but they are hampered by the "outside looking in" aspect of workstation-based visualization. At the Electronic Visualization Laboratory (EVL) at the University of Illinois at Chicago, we are attempting to break some of the visualization barriers with a distributed computing and visualization environment developed using the Cave Automatic Virtual Environment (CAVE) virtual reality theater. In particular, we are trying to provide physicists and astrophysicists at the National Center for Supercomputing Applications (NCSA) a new vehicle for scientific discovery.<>
